- The distance between Silute, Lithuania and Damascus (Intl), Syria is approximately 2,704 km or 1,680 mi.
- To reach Silute in this distance one would set out from Damascus (Intl) bearing 339°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Silute bearing 328.2° or NNW .
- Silute has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Damascus (Intl) has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Silute is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Damascus (Intl) is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ome.
- The mean temperature is 10.4 °C (18.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.1 °C (0.2°F) more in Silute. The continentality subtype is semicont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 653.3 mm (25.7 in) more which is equivalent to 653.3 l/m² (16.03 US gal/ft²) or 6,533,000 l/ha (698,421 US gal/ac) more. About 5 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.9° lower in Silute than in Damascus (Intl).
